While Pemberton train station may not boast the extensive amenities of larger stations, it provides the essentials needed for your journey. There is no ticket office, but conveniently, ticket machines are available to purchase and collect pre-booked tickets. The station caters to those with accessibility needs with an induction loop and accessible ticket machines ensuring all passengers can travel with ease.
The station's design includes step-free access, which is partially available, making it somewhat accommodating for those with mobility issues. There's a slope to the platforms servicing routes to Wigan and Manchester via a ramp, while a cobblestone path provides access to routes toward Kirkby. Passengers are advised that facilities like waiting rooms, ATM machines, and restrooms are not present at this station, so planning ahead is recommended.
Pemberton station also serves as a connection point to other modes of transport. The rail replacement services operate near the bus stops on Billinge Road, conveniently located just 30 meters from the station. When it comes to purchasing tickets at West Worthing, travelers enjoy the convenience of a ticket office with ample opening hours, operating from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ays, slightly extended on Saturdays, and reduced hours on Sundays. For those who prefer a more digital approach, ticket machines are on hand and ready to assist, including facilities for collecting pre-purchased tickets. The station also supports Southern's smartcard system, with both issuing and validating capabilities available.
Step-free access is another highlight here, meeting the needs of passengers requiring additional support. The station's essential facilities, such as staff-operated ramps, make it accessible. It's worth noting though that waiting rooms are absent, but there are seating areas available. While there's no provision for luggage storage or accessible toilets, the station does maintain CCTV for added security.
Refreshment choices are somewhat limited, yet there's a refreshment facility available to grab a quick bite. Those needing cash would need to plan ahead, as there are no ATM facilities onsite.
For those relying on public transport beyond the rail, the station is well-connected. While there's no dedicated bus stop directly at the station, accessible taxi services can be found on Tarring Road.
